Burger
1. Form the Patty
Lightly shape the 1/2 lb ground beef into a single patty about 3/4 to 1 inch thick and slightly wider than the bun. Do not overwork the meat — press gently to avoid compacting. Create a shallow dimple in the center with your thumb to prevent puffing during cooking.
2. Season
Season both sides of the patty with the k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per just before cooking.
3. Preheat Grill or Pan
Preheat a grill to high (450–500°F / 232–260°C) or heat a heavy skillet/griddle over medium-high heat. If using a skillet, add 1 tsp vegetable oil and heat until shimmering.
4. Cook
Place the patty on the hot grill or skillet. For a flame-broiled flavor on stovetop, let the pan get very hot and resist pressing the patty. Cook for 4–5 minutes on the first side without moving to develop a brown crust.
5. Flip and Finish
Flip the patty and cook for another 3–5 minutes for medium (internal temperature ~160°F / 71°C for well-done per USDA guidelines; cook to desired doneness). If using cheese, place the slice on the patty during the last minute and cover the grill or pan to melt.
6. Rest
Transfer the cooked patty to a plate and let rest for 2–3 minutes to allow juices to redistribute.
Bun & Toppings
7. Toast the Bun: While the patty rests, spread 1 tsp softened butter or a thin smear of mayonnaise on the cut faces of the brioche bun. Place cut-side down on the hot grill or skillet for 30–60 seconds until golden and slightly crisp. Remove to a plate.
8. Prep Vegetables: Rinse and pat dry the lettuce leaf. Slice the tomato into 2 even slices (about 1/4 inch thick). If using onion, slice into rings and separate. Prepare pickles if desired.
9. Assemble: On the bottom half of the toasted brioche bun place the lettuce leaf, then the tomato slices. Add any pickles or onion rings you prefer. Place the rested burger patty (with melted cheese if used) on top of the tomato. Spread ketchup, mustard, and/or mayonnaise on the top bun and close the sandwich.
Serving
10. Serve immediately while hot with your choice of sides (fries, chips, or a side salad). If desired, secure the burger with a toothpick and slice in half for easier eating.
